Gabily confirms fight with Anitta for alleged plagiarism: ‘We had a mismatch’

by

The singer Gabily, 27, spoke about her fight with Anitta, 29. Alongside the digital influencer Vanessa Lopes, 21, she commented in an interview with PodCats about an alleged plagiarism and gave more details about what happened between her and the artist nominated for the Grammy. “Nowadays we don’t talk anymore, but I admire her work.”

A few months ago Gabily accused someone of plagiarism on her networks, without naming names. The publication came shortly after Anitta launched a partnership with the Free Fire game. “People take your idea in the face and pass you backwards, without pity! This just confirms to me that I was never the wrong one”, he said at the time.

In the conversation, Gabily said that she was disappointed with Anitta and confirmed that the fight happened at the time. “I’ve always respected, I’ll always respect, a lot what Anitta means to me. But we had a mismatch because of a project that I even talked about on the internet, before talking to her on WhatsApp.”

“I sent the prints because it was something very similar to what I had shown her two years before she released it”, he explained. Gabily said that, after the conversation with Anitta, her outburst ended up gaining more repercussions and the disagreement between the two increased.

“I ended up posting [uma indireta] on my social network, before I talk to her [Anitta]🇧🇷 And then after I talked to her, I understood. Only this thing that I posted and deleted reverberated after three days, “she explained.

She says she still suspects if everything wasn’t set up to generate a bigger mess. “It seems that someone planted that there, because I had already resolved it with her. Then this thing that I posted reverberated and she said: ‘Wow, I said that the conversation would stay between us. Now you posted the thing on your social network?’.”
